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kirknewton to Severn Tunnel Junction start from as little as £105.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kirknewton to Severn Tunnel Junction are available for £244.60 one way, or £488.90 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ities

Kirknewton station operates without a ticket office, so passengers are encouraged to purchase tickets online in advance of their trip because there are no ticket machines available for collection. Smartcards are a convenient solution for regular travelers, and, fortunately, Kirknewton is equipped with smartcard validators. Additionally, there are customer help points to aid travelers, and the station is secure with CCTV surveillance, ensuring a safe environment for all railway users.

Accessibility and Services

While some step-free access is provided, visitors should note that there is a single Blue Badge parking bay and step-free access across the station. The station lacks a ramp for train access, so travelers with specific mobility needs should plan accordingly. There are no toilets or refreshment facilities, so guests are advised to prepare ahead of their visit. For those requiring assistance, the station is part of the Passenger Assist program, allowing for assistance booking in advance.

Transport Links

Traveling onward from Kirknewton is a breeze, with buses available from a stop conveniently located at the station's pedestrian entrance. You can visit Travel Line Scotland for full details about available bus services, and taxi services can be organized via the handy Train Taxi website when required.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Severn Tunnel Junction station is well-equipped for all traveler needs. With ticket machines that are accessible, travelers can easily purchase and collect their tickets purchased online. However, bear in mind that no ticket office may be staffed outside of its opening hours, which are early morning to late morning on weekdays.

Accessibility is a key focus at this station. Step-free access is available across the entire station including to all platforms via a footbridge with ramps, making it user-friendly for families with buggies or travelers with mobility challenges. Although waiting rooms are not available, there is a comfortable seating area where passengers can wait for their trains.

Car parking is ample with more than 100 spaces available, six of which are reserved for those requiring accessible parking. Plus, it's all free! CCTV ensures added security for vehicles left in the station's car park which operates 24 hours daily.

Onward Travel Options From Severn Tunnel Junction

The station provides diverse onward travel options, making it a convenient hub for exploring the greater region. Located directly inside the station's car park is the rail replacement bus stop, crucial for continued travel during those rare instances when trains are unavailable. Although no cycle hire services exist, the station fares well for cyclists with secure housing for bicycles, complete with CCTV monitoring.
